Cost of Storm Drain Maintenance in Marana
Maintaining storm drains is crucial for preventing flooding and ensuring proper drainage in Marana, AZ. Regular maintenance helps to keep these systems functioning efficiently, but it comes with associated costs. Understanding the factors that influence these costs and the common tasks involved can help residents and businesses budget appropriately for storm drain maintenance.
Factors Influencing Costs
- Size of the Drainage System: Larger systems require more resources and time to clean and maintain.
- Frequency of Maintenance: Regular maintenance can prevent costly repairs, but increases ongoing expenses.
- Type of Debris: Different types of debris, such as leaves, sediment, or trash, can affect the complexity and cost of cleaning.
- Accessibility: Drains that are difficult to access may require specialized equipment or additional labor.
- Weather Conditions: Extreme weather can exacerbate issues and increase maintenance needs.
- Local Regulations: Compliance with local regulations can add to the overall cost of maintenance.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Marana, AZ) |
---|---|
Basic Cleaning | $150 - $300 per drain |
Inspection and Assessment | $100 - $200 per hour |
Debris Removal | $200 - $400 per drain |
Sediment Removal | $300 - $500 per drain |
Repair of Minor Damages | $200 - $600 per incident |
Installation of New Drains | $1,500 - $3,000 per drain |
Emergency Services | $500 - $1,000 per incident |
